Food chain pathogen monitoring
Food chain pathogen monitoring focuses on detecting, tracking, and controlling infectious agents that move through food production, processing, distribution, and consumption systems. This session explores how contamination can occur at multiple stages of the food supply network and how systematic monitoring helps reduce infection risks. Pathogens may enter the food chain at farm level, during processing, or through improper storage and handling practices. Once introduced, they can persist across multiple stages, leading to widespread exposure events. Common organisms include bacterial, viral, and parasitic agents that can survive under varied environmental conditions, making detection and control a complex challenge for food safety systems.
Effective monitoring requires coordinated testing protocols, hazard analysis systems, and traceability mechanisms that allow authorities to identify contamination sources quickly. Strengthening laboratory capacity and implementing standardized inspection frameworks are essential for maintaining food safety. Digital tracking technologies are increasingly used to map food movement and detect contamination points more efficiently.
From a systems perspective, Food Chain Surveillance describes structured monitoring processes designed to identify and control infectious hazards within food production networks, ensuring early detection of contamination and reducing the risk of widespread foodborne outbreaks.
